Power management method using fabric network and fabric network system using power management method

US10001827B2 · US · B2

Patent metadata
FieldValue
Publication numberUS-10001827-B2
Application numberUS-201615291266-A
CountryUS
Kind codeB2
Filing dateOct 12, 2016
Priority dateNov 23, 2015
Publication dateJun 19, 2018
Grant dateJun 19, 2018

How to read this patent

A practical reading order for non-experts. Skip the full description unless you need deep technical detail.

  1. Title

    What the patent document calls the invention.

  2. Abstract

    A short plain-language summary of the technical disclosure.

  3. Assignees and inventors

    Who owns or filed the patent and who is credited as inventor.

  4. Key dates

    Filing, priority, publication, and grant dates set the timeline.

  5. First independent claim

    The legal scope of protection — read this for what is actually claimed.

  6. CPC / IPC classifications

    Technology tags used to group this patent with similar filings.

  7. Citations and related patents

    Prior art links and similar publications in this corpus.

Abstract

Official abstract text for this publication.

A power management method includes monitoring a status of an external interface of external interfaces between the fabric network and at least one host, and a status of an internal interface of internal interfaces between the fabric network and at least one storage device of a plurality of storage devices. The power management method further includes calculating aggregate information of bandwidths of internal interfaces of the plurality of storage devices based on the monitoring, the at least one storage device connected to the at least one host. The method further includes adjusting the bandwidths of the internal interfaces such that the aggregate information of the bandwidths of the internal interfaces is within a threshold range, the threshold range based on a bandwidth of the external interface connected to the at least one host.

First claim

Opening claim text (preview).

What is claimed is: 1. A power management method using a fabric network, the power management method comprising: monitoring a status of at least one of a number of external interfaces between the fabric network and at least one host, and monitoring a status of at least one of a plurality of internal interfaces between the fabric network and at least one storage device, the at least one host configured to access the at least one storage device through the fabric network; calculating aggregate information of bandwidths of the plurality of internal interfaces based on the monitoring of the status of the at least one of the number of external interfaces and the at least one host; and adjusting the bandwidths of the plurality of internal interfaces such that the aggregate information of the bandwidths of the plurality of internal interfaces is within a threshold range, the threshold range being based on a bandwidth of the at least one of the number of external interfaces connected to the at least one host. 2. The power management method of claim 1 , wherein the monitoring the status of the at least one of the number of external interfaces includes, detecting the bandwidth of the at least one of the number of external interfaces based on external interface bandwidth configuration information, and the monitoring the status of the at least of the plurality of internal interfaces includes, detecting the bandwidths of the plurality of the internal interfaces based on internal interface bandwidth configuration information. 3. The power management method of claim 1 , wherein the adjusting the bandwidths of the plurality of internal interfaces includes, setting a first bandwidth of the threshold range as a sum of (i) the bandwidth of the at least one of the number of external interfaces and (ii) a first threshold value, and setting a second bandwidth of the threshold range as a sum of (i) the bandwidth of the at least one of the number of external interfaces and (ii) a second threshold value, the second threshold value is greater than the first threshold value. 4. The power management method of claim 3 , further comprising: maintaining an input/output performance according to the bandwidth of the at least one of the number of external interfaces based on the first and second threshold values; and reducing a power consumption by the at least one storage device while maintaining the input/output performance. 5. The power management method of claim 4 , further comprising: determining the first threshold value and the second threshold value based on empirical data. 6. The power management method of claim 1 , wherein the adjusting the bandwidths of the plurality of internal interfaces includes, determining the threshold range based on a correlation between a number of the at least one storage device configured to access the fabric network, an input/output performance of the bandwidths of the plurality of internal interfaces, and power consumption of the at least one storage device. 7. The power management method of claim 1 , wherein the calculating calculates the aggregate information of the bandwidths of the plurality of internal interfaces if a plurality of the at least one host access the fabric network. 8. The power management method of claim 7 , wherein the adjusting the bandwidths of the plurality of internal interfaces includes, adjusting the bandwidths of the plurality of internal interfaces based on bandwidths of the number of external interfaces such that the aggregate information of the bandwidths of the plurality of internal interfaces is within the threshold range, the bandwidths of the number of external interfaces connected to the plurality of the at least one host. 9. The power management method of claim 1 , further comprising: mapping groups of a plurality of the at least one storage device to a plurality of the at least one host based on bandwidths of the plurality of the at least one host if the plurality of the at least one host access the fabric network. 10. The power management method of claim 9 , wherein the adjusting adjusts the bandwidths of the plurality of internal interfaces based on the calculated aggregate information of the bandwidth of at least one of the plurality of internal interfaces and the bandwidth of the at least one of the number of external interfaces. 11. The power management method of claim 1 , further comprising: connecting the at least one host and the at least one storage device via an interface, the interface includes one of a Component Interconnect Express (PCIe) interface, a Serial Attached Small Computer System Interface (SAS), a Serial Advanced Technology Attachment (SATA) interface, and a network interface. 12. A fabric network system comprising: a fabric network including a plurality of ports, the fabric network configured to support communication between a host and a plurality of storage devices, the plurality of storage devices connected to access the plurality of ports, a monitor configured to, monitor a status of an external interface connected to the host, and monitor statuses of internal interfaces connected to the plurality of storage devices; and a controller configured to, adjust bandwidths of the internal interfaces based on the monitored status of the external interface and the monitored statuses of the internal interfaces such that a bandwidth used by the host is maintained and power consumption of the plurality of storage devices is reduced. 13. The fabric network system of claim 12 , wherein the monitor is further configured to, detect a bandwidth of the external interface based on external interface bandwidth configuration information, and detect the bandwidths of the internal interfaces based on internal interface bandwidth configuration information from the host. 14. The fabric network system of claim 12 , wherein the controller is further configured to, calculate aggregate information of the bandwidths of the internal interfaces based on the monitored status of the external interface and the monitored statuses of the internal interfaces, and adjust the bandwidths of the internal interfaces such that the calculated aggregate information of the bandwidths of the internal interfaces is within a threshold range based on a bandwidth of the external interface. 15. The fabric network system of claim 12 , wherein the controller is further configured to, map groups of the plurality of storage devices to the host based on the bandwidth used by the host if the host accesses the fabric network, and adjust the bandwidths of the internal interfaces for the mapped groups of the plurality of storage devices. 16. A power management method comprising: calculating aggregate information of bandwidths of a plurality of storage devices in a storage system, each of the plurality of storage devices configured to access a host connected to a fabric network in the storage system, and reducing power consumption of the plurality of storage devices by adjusting bandwidths of internal interfaces between the fabric network and the plurality of storage devices based on (i) the calculated aggregate information of the bandwidths of the plurality of storage devices, and (ii) a bandwidth of an external interface between the host and the fabric network. 17. The power management method of claim 16 , wherein the reducing the power consumption of the plurality of storage devices includes, adjusting the bandwidths of the internal interfaces such that the calculated aggregate information of the bandwidths of the in

Assignees

Inventors

Classifications

  • for performance assessment · CPC title

  • Power saving in memory, e.g. RAM, cache · CPC title

  • G06F1/3209Primary

    Monitoring remote activity, e.g. over telephone lines or network connections · CPC title

  • where the monitored property is the power consumption (power management in a computing system G06F1/3203) · CPC title

  • for interfaces, buses · CPC title

Patent family

Related publications grouped by family.

External sources

Frequently asked questions

Answers are generated from the same data shown on this page.

What does patent US10001827B2 cover?
A power management method includes monitoring a status of an external interface of external interfaces between the fabric network and at least one host, and a status of an internal interface of internal interfaces between the fabric network and at least one storage device of a plurality of storage devices. The power management method further includes calculating aggregate information of bandwid…
Who is the assignee on this patent?
Samsung Electronics Co Ltd
What technology area does this patent fall under?
Primary CPC classification G06F1/3209. Mapped technology areas include Physics.
When was this patent published?
Publication date Tue Jun 19 2018 00:00:00 GMT+0000 (Coordinated Universal Time) (B2). Legal status and post-grant events are not shown on this page.
What related patents are in patentsdb?
We list 2 related publications on this page (citations in our corpus or others sharing the same primary CPC).